How did senator orrin hatch want to punish people for illegally downloading music files?

Senator Orrin Hatch from Utah proposed the idea of destroying computers that are used for unauthorized music file downloads. He encouraged the creation of technology that could remotely eliminate or damage computers engaged in music piracy. Additionally, he emphasized that violating copyright laws has no justification and those responsible should face penalties like having their computers destroyed.
